首页文章正文

先序遍历输入一个二叉树,中序遍历二叉树

前序遍历二叉排序树 2023-12-05 10:29 477 墨鱼
前序遍历二叉排序树

先序遍历输入一个二叉树,中序遍历二叉树

先序遍历输入一个二叉树,中序遍历二叉树

∪△∪ 二叉树遍历一般有四种,分别是前序遍历、中序遍历、后序遍历、层次遍历。前三者的区别在于输出当前节点的时间。第一个输出是前序,中间输出是中序。 ,最终的输出是后序的。对于层次遍历,编写一个程序来读取用户输入的前序遍历的字符串,并基于该字符串构建二叉树(存储为指针)。 例如下面的前序遍历字符串:ABC##DE#G##F####,其中""代表

1.思路是基于递归遍历的,比如前序遍历124005600700300-1(0表示当前节点为空,1表示输入为空)2.构造二叉树1.首先判断遍历的顺序如上面所写。首先,我们知道二叉树的中序遍历和后序遍历,求其前序遍历二叉树。输入有多个组。第一行是一个整数(t<1000),这意味着有多个组。 测试数据。 每组由长度小于50的两个单词组成

编写程序读取用户输入的预序遍历字符串,并根据该字符串构建二叉树(存储为指针)。 例如,以下预序遍历字符串:ABC##DE#G##F###,其中""表示我们的第一个输入数据是bc##de#g##f###。以预序为例。 好了,进入前序函数后,根据前序遍历的定义(简单记为:rootleft和right,先访问根节点,然后访问左孩子,左孩子

使用二叉树预序遍历方法创建二叉树(预序构建二叉树的输入顺序为:AB#D##C#E##),然后对二叉树进行前序遍历(非递归),并输出遍历结果#include#编写程序读取用户输入的预序遍历字符串,并基于指针构建二叉树在此字符串上。 例如下面的前序遍历字符串:ABC##DE#G##F####,其中""代表

后台-插件-广告管理-内容页尾部广告(手机)

标签: 中序遍历二叉树

发表评论

评论列表

佛跳墙加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号